New records demonstrate how Bayer's asundexian stopped working to avoid strokes

.Bayer put on hold the stage 3 test for its aspect XIa inhibitor asundexian late in 2013 after the medication presented "inferior effectiveness" at stopping movements in patients along with atrial fibrillation reviewed to Bristol Myers Squibb and Pfizer's Eliquis. The complete photo of what that "inferior efficiency" seems like has currently come into concentration: People obtaining asundexian actually endured strokes or systemic blood clots at a greater fee than those acquiring Eliquis.In a 14,810-patient research, referred to OCEANIC-AF, 98 patients getting Bayer's drug endured strokes or even systemic embolisms, reviewed to 26 people acquiring Eliquis, during the time the test was actually called off too soon due to the concerning fad, according to trial results published Sept. 1 in The New England Publication of Medicine. Avoiding movement was the test's key efficiency endpoint.Negative occasion incidence was comparable in between asundexian and Eliquis, yet 147 individuals stopped Bayer's medication due to negative events compared to 118 endings for individuals on Eliquis. Concerning two times as lots of patients (155) acquiring asundexian died of cardiac arrest, shock or yet another cardiovascular activity contrasted to 77 in the Eliquis team.
Atrial fibrillation is a sporadic, typically rapid heart beat that increases the risk of stroke as well as heart failure. Eliquis targets variable Xa, the activated kind of an enzyme that is actually essential for initiating the coagulation procedure, when red blood cell lot together and also develop embolisms. Avoiding coagulation minimizes the odds that embolism form and also take a trip to the mind, inducing a stroke, yet additionally increases the threat of unsafe bleeding since the body is less able to cease the circulation of blood stream.Bayer found to thwart the blood loss risk by chasing an intended additionally down the coagulation path, referred to as aspect XIa. Asundexian succeeded hereof, as just 17 individuals who acquired asundexian had actually primary bleeding compared to 53 who obtained Eliquis, hitting the trial's primary protection endpoint. Yet this boosted safety, the information show, came at the reduction of effectiveness.Private investigators have recommended some ideas concerning why asundexian has actually failed in spite of the promise of the variable XIa mechanism. They recommend the asundexian dosage checked, at fifty mg daily, may possess been actually too low to attain high adequate levels of aspect XIa obstacle. In a previous test, PACIFIC-AF, this dosage lessened factor XIa task by 94% at peak attentions stopping unsafe blood clotting buildup might take close to one hundred% task reduction, the authors advise.The test was made to finish as soon as 350 people had actually experienced strokes or blood clots as well as was actually only over a third of the technique there certainly when Bayer pulled the plug at the recommendation of the individual data monitoring board. The test started signing up people Dec. 5, 2022, as well as ended on Nov. 19 of the list below year.Asundexian has had a hard time in other evidence too the drug failed to lower the cost of covert human brain infarction or ischemic strokes in a period 2 test in 2022. In 2023, Bayer requirements that the blood stream thinner could possibly produce $5.5 billion each year as a potential therapy for thrombosis and movement avoidance.The German pharma titan is reassessing its own prepare for another test, OCEANIC-AFINA, implied for a part of atrial fibrillation patients with a higher threat for movement or wide spread blood clot that are actually unacceptable for dental anticoagulation therapy. An additional late-stage trial analyzing just how asundexian compare to standard-of-care antiplatelets in ischemic stroke protection, referred to as OCEANIC-STROKE, is actually on-going. That trial is actually anticipated to enlist 12,300 patients and also finish in October 2025.Bayer's rivals in the ethnicity to hinder factor XIa have also battled. BMS and also Johnson &amp Johnson's milvexian neglected a phase 2 trial, however the pharma is actually still pursuing a stage 3..
